Concrete Lifting Thompson Riverview Terrace
Concrete lifting, also called slabjacking, foamjacking or mudjacking is the act of drilling openings right into concrete and infusing product below the concrete in order to raise it to level. TCS just uses high-density polyurethane foam for lasting repairs.

Deep Foam Injection
Deep foam injection entails driving long rods right into ground to infuse high density polyurethane foam in soils. This can be used to maintain or lift soils and structures, in addition to displace water.Residential Concrete Lifting Contractor

Spray Foam Insulation
Spray polyurethane foam insulation can be used in both residential and commercial buildings. Spray polyurethane foam can be acquired in closed or open cell kinds. Because it serves as an insulation, air seal and vapor obstacle, closed cell foam is great for chillier climate areas. This item is truly a three-in-one and greatly enhances the framework’s stamina. Spray foam is costly upfront, but it can conserve you as much as 50% on your air conditioning and heating costs. This will result in a fast return on investment.
Blown In Insulation Thompson Riverview Terrace
Blown-in fiberglass and cellulose are usually used in attics in a loose fill system. Blown-in insulation can also be used in wall systems with the BIBS (blown in blanket system) or thick pack. TCS supplies both solutions to customers based upon our customers requirements and budget.
